How to Spot Predatory Bait-and-Switch Pricing Tactics Instantly
The biggest trap in the security industry is the twenty-dollar lockout special advertised by rogue dispatch centers that route your call to out-of-state call hubs. When the technician finally arrives, that low quote balloons into hundreds of dollars under the guise of specialized drilling or complex hardware fees. To protect your wallet, always verify that you are hiring a legitimate local Seattle locksmith who operates out of a physical address in King County. Request a firm breakdown of labor and parts before they touch your door. If a dispatcher hesitates to provide realistic cost ranges or refuses to guarantee their work, hang up and call a different local professional.

Is it cheaper to replace my entire deadbolt or just rekey the locks on my Westfield house?
Rekeying your existing locks is almost always more budget-friendly than replacing the entire hardware set. A professional locksmith simply adjusts the internal pins so old keys no longer work, saving you money.
